Why Are My Crinkles Hard?
There are several possible reasons why crinkles may be hard. One reason is that the dough may have been overworked, causing the gluten to develop too much, resulting in a dense and tough texture. Another possibility is that the cookies were baked for too long, causing them to become dry and hard. It could also be due to the ingredients or the recipe used, such as not having enough moisture or using too much flour.
